15 partners from 7 EU countries work together to transform waste from the poultry industry into bio-based products for agricultural applications. The UNLOCK project, funded by the Bio-based Industries Joint Undertaking (BBI JU), aims at designing economically and environmentally sustainable innovative value chains to create a feather based bio-economy. In the course for the four-years project, the feathers will be valorised through four different processes, from mechanical treatment to steam explosion, microbial fermentaion or chemical hydrolysis, depending on the type of end products desired. The bio-based products generated will be tailored to the needs of the agriculture sector, with the creation of seed trays, nonwoven geotextiles, mulch films and hydroponic foams. Futhermore, the keratin contained in those innovative materials will bring additional environmental benefits at the end of the product’s life: keratin-based materials are targeted to be zero waste and allow for controlled biodegradability, while also enriching soils with organic nitrogen. The UNLOCK project is lead by the CIDETEC Foundation. It receives funding from the @EU_H2020 Research & Innovation Programme granted by @BBI2020 under grant agreement nº 101023306. It officially started on 1st May 2021 and will run until April 2025. 🎙️ Podcast Update: new episode is out! 🌍 In this episode, we're joined by Jonna Almqvist from Processum Biorefinery Cluster, part of RISE Research Institutes of Sweden, to discuss their crucial role in refining steam explosion technology. This innovative method allows to convert chicken feathers into bio-plastics by efficiently extracting keratin. We also discuss the technological advancements made to scale this process at the biorefinery demo plant in Sweden, aiming for sustainable large-scale processing. 🎉 We're thrilled to announce that UNIMOS Alliance, as part of the UNLOCK_project consortium, presented its groundbreaking project at the BIOKET Bioeconomy Key Enabling Technologies platform Conference last week! 🌱🌍 The UNLOCK project aims to transform waste from the European poultry sector into bio-based products designed specifically for agricultural applications. The innovative materials created through four different technical processes will include seed trays, nonwoven geotextiles, mulch films, and hydroponic foams, tailored to the needs of the agriculture sector. The UNLOCK project is a groundbreaking initiative led by the CIDETEC Foundation and funded by the Bio-based Industries Joint Undertaking (BBI JU). This project is in line with the EU Bioeconomy Strategy, and it aims to design economically and environmentally sustainable innovative value chains. The project's keratin-based materials are targeted to be zero waste and allow for controlled biodegradability, while also enriching soils with organic nitrogen, delivering additional environmental benefits at the end of the product's life. 🌿♻️🌱 We are proud to be part of this exciting project, which brings together 15 partners from 7 EU countries in a collaborative effort to drive sustainable innovation.
